Resume Keywords to Include
Make sure these keywords appear in your resume to improve ATS scoring
PythonSQLAzureApacheMySQLMongoDBSnowflakeSparkdbt
Sign up free to auto-tailor your resume with all these keywords and get a higher ATS score
Job Description
Responsibilities
- Drive the completion of data projects and deliverables, including the execution of highly complex data solutions.
- Demonstrate best practices, processes, and standards for user story development, data analysis, architecture, modeling, design, coding, and testing.
- Lead or assist in the development, documentation, and maintenance of the enterprise data architecture and its deliverables.
- Design principles, models, and mappings for transactional and analytical systems, serving both strategic and tactical needs.
- Work closely with the business, mapping their most pressing business problems to data and analytic solutions.
- Develop data models and data transformation logic.
- Work with data engineers to implement data pipelines.
- Prototype data solutions to enable the measurement or monitoring of key performance indicators.
- Collaborate with senior management to understand data needs in support of departmental goals.
- Partner with product owners and managers in developing scope, dependencies, estimates, project plans, schedules, status reporting, and issue\/risk management.
- Become the subject matter expert in multiple data domains.
- Define company standards around data quality.
- Maximize opportunities to implement self-service to allow the business to find the data they need quickly, easily, and accurately.
- Enable the data science team to build ML models by designing and providing high-quality data.
- Establish and maintain effective and positive relationships with internal and external customers.
Required Skills
- BS degree in Computer Science, Engineering, Mathematics, or a related field and 8 years of work experience.
- Advanced knowledge in translating business rules to technical data requirements.
- Advanced SQL knowledge.
- Expertise in building data warehouses.
- Advanced knowledge of user story development, data warehouse design and modeling (3rd normal form and dimensional modeling), data integration design and development, and\/or performance tuning.
- Excellent skills in coordination with multiple teams for project execution and issue resolution.
- Demonstrated oral\/written communication and presentation skills to effectively communicate complex technical information while inspiring and motivating others.
- Advanced problem-solving and troubleshooting skills.
- Advanced knowledge of work estimation, design review, code review, and data testing techniques.
- Willingness to play multiple roles for different projects, e.g., data analyst, developer, tester, etc.
- Advanced knowledge of big data platforms (e.g., Data Bricks, Delta Lake, Apache Spark, Snowflake, Redshift).
- Experience with Relational Database Management Systems (e.g., Azure SQL, SQL Server, Oracle, MySQL) and NoSQL databases (e.g., MongoDB).
- Knowledge of ETL processing tools (e.g., DBT, Databricks, Python).
- A commitment to data security and privacy.
Location: Remote - Canada, Mexico
Skills required for this job:
- Data Privacy
- Data analysis
- Data architecture
- Data modeling
- Data security
- Data visualization
- Python
- Redshift
- SQL
- Snowflake
- Technology data architecture
Similar Jobs
Java PL/SQL Developer
QUANTEAM - North America (RAINBOW PARTNERS Group)
Québec City, Quebec, CA
Senior AI/ML Engineer
Uber
San Francisco, California, US
Security Engineer, Detection & Response - Global Security Organization
TikTok
Washington, District of Columbia, US
Software Security Engineer Jobs
Squires Group, Inc
Washington, District of Columbia, US
Lead Software Engineer (Java)
CIBC
Toronto, Ontario, CA
Want AI-powered job matching?
Upload your resume and get every job scored, your resume tailored, and hiring manager emails found - automatically.
Get Started Free